8. Audio IO
Configuration Example
In the example described below, the network topology shall be a single Layer 2 switch using hitless merge with
an external PTP GrandMaster clock, and four connecting POWER COREs on two announcement rings. For the
first POWER CORE the Sat Receiver inputs will be available to all other systems, whereas the Codec inputs will
be available to the first two systems only. There are four parts to the configuration:
Ø
Step 1 - Configure the Output Streams for each POWER CORE
Open the
"Audio Output ->
edit the parameters as follows:
Group
Give each POWER CORE a descriptive and recognizable Group name, such as CORE1..4. The group
shall start with an alpha character and not numeral.
Name
Each outgoing stream for the Group shall also be given a descriptive name, e.g. SatRx01..08,
Codec01..06, etc. Remember to keep to the 8 character limit.
Default Audio
In this example the "baseband" inputs are being converted to AoIP streams and each should ideally
receive a default audio route from the corresponding input card. Double click on the pink cell and
select the relevant input.
Stream Size
In this example we are going to be using stereo streams. To optimize the packetizing process, 8
channels streams could be selected or even larger to reduce overhead.
Codec
L24 = linear 24 bits, is a good standard to use.
Samples per
32 or 48 is typical for stereo streams. Do not exceed the MTU of 1500 bytes otherwise the packets will
Frame
most likely get fragmented by the switches (jumbo packets). 24 bit stereo samples with 48 samples
per frame = 288 bytes. For example an 8 channel stream would have 1152 bytes.
Devices
The requirement for Hitless Merge means ra0and ra1 will be selected. The stream will be transmitted
on both NIC's and the SDP will let the receiver know that it's a redundant stream.
Multicast
The default range of multicast addresses will be used. The octets take a portion of their address from
Address
the Ravenna NIC's, namely the 3rd and 4th and are arranged as follows: 239.3rdoctet.4thoctet.x, where
x increments for each output stream starting from the first.
Discovery
The design called for two announcement rings. As this is a L2 network, mDNS Channels 1 and 2 shall
be used. Obtain (from network admin) and configure the multicast addresses in the System / Definition
/ Stream Announcement section according to the design. In CORE1..4 enable the Channel 1 and in
CORE1..2 enable Channel 2.
Return to Audio Output / Ravenna and tab RAVENNA Out 1-64 and for the streams associated with
SatRx01..08 tick the check box mDNS 1 and 2 and for Codec01..08 tick mDNS 2 only.
Enable
Enter a True in the logic Enable field to ensure the streams get broadcast after startup.

Step 2 - Configure the Input Streams for each POWER CORE
Open the
"Audio Input ->
the parameters as follows:
Group
Give each POWER CORE a descriptive and recognizable Group name, such as CORE1..4. The group
shall start with an alpha character and not numeral.
Name
Each input will receive a stream off the network and the question is whether to tie them permanently to
the input or give the input a generic name. In this example the input will be given a generic name, e.g.
In001..032 and be made stereo to correspond to the streams on the network.
Stream Size
In this example we are going to be using stereo streams. To optimize the packetizing process, 8
channels streams could be selected or even larger to reduce overhead.
Default Stream Include the stream name in the event that these inputs will always be connected to the relevant
network stream, e.g. CORE1:SatRx01
RAVENNA
Instead of using the Default Stream position to enter a default stream, the RAVENNA Connect element
Connect /
could be used for triggered subscription to streams, or the RAVENNA Stream Control element could
Stream Control
be used should there be Primary and Backup streams associated with the input.
